6.1 Uncrating
The envelope attached to the shipping box contains
the uncrating instructions of the machine (Figure 6-1).
Cut straps. Cut out staple positions along the
bottom of the shipping box (or remove staples
with an appropriate tool - Figure 6-2)
After cutting out or removing the staples,
lift the shipping box in order to clear the machine
(two persons required).
Transport the machine with a fork-lift truck to
the operating position. Lift the pallet at the
point indicated in Figure 6-3.
(weight of machine + pallet = See Specifications).
6.2 Disposal of Packaging Materials
The 200a package is composed of:
- Wooden pallet
- Cardboard shipping box
- Wooden supports
- Metal xing brackets
- PU foam protection
- PP plastic straps
- Dehydrating salts in bag
- Special bag of laminated polyester/aluminium/
Polyethylene (sea freight package only)
- Polyethylene protective material
For the disposal of the above materials, please follow
the environmental directives or the law in your country.

Removal of Pallet
Using a 10mm combination wrench, remove the
fasteners that secure the case sealer legs to pallet
at each leg (as shown in Figure 6-4).
A package is located under the machine body.
Retrieve the instruction manual for additional
procedures of the set up. The package also
contains parts removed for shipping, spare parts
and tools (Figure 6-5).
